Man Utd target to leave Wolves for Napoli?

Manchester United target Joao Gomes could be on his way to Napoli from Wolverhampton Wanderers this winter, according to Tuttomercatoweb.
The Brazil international has been a key player in the centre of the park for the Midlands outfit, but he could be on the move in the coming days.
Wolves look almost destined for Premier League relegation, given they are languishing 20th in the table and 14 points adrift of the safe zone.
It is now reported that the Serie A champions are working hard to land Gomes and negotiations are already underway with Wolves for the player.
Gomes has already agreed personal terms with Napoli, but he won't come on the cheap with Wolves set to demand at least £40 million for him.
United have also been credited with an interest in his services, but they are unlikely to make such a huge outlay and prefer a low-cost addition.
The club could sign Al-Hilal midfielder Ruben Neves for £20m.
